| V.5.10.D.4. | Check Valves | Add | Provide single disc swing check valves designed to allow a full diameter passage and to operate with a minimum loss of pressure. Provide 1/8 through 3 inch check valves that meet the requirements of MSS SP-80. Provide 4 inch through 24 inch check valves that meet the requirements of AWWA C508. Equip check valves with bronze renewable seat rings, bronze discs or disc rings and bronze disc hinge bushings and pins. Carefully mount discs and provide discs that swivel in disc hinges. Provide pins, discs and other parts that are noncorrosive, nonsticking and properly cured to operate satisfactorily within a temperature range of 34 to 100 degrees Farenheit and with the fluids specified. Equip 6 inch and larger check valves with outside levers and weights. Provide check valves manufactured by American Flow Control, Clow Valve, M&H Valve, Mueller Valve, or approved equal. | ||||||

| II.2.2.E.7.d. | Trench Bedding and Backfilling | Add | “The City may, at any time, require compaction testing to ensure compliance with the specifications. A recognized testing laboratory that is selected by the City will conduct all tests. The testing laboratory is to be qualified in the field of the materials to be tested. If applicable, all tests will be conducted in accordance with V.D.O.T.’S “Manual for Virginia Testing Methods” (Current Edition, as Revised). Payment for all tests will be in accordance with the following: A) The cost of all tests failing to meet the minimum requirements will be borne by the Contractor. B) The costs of all tests that either meet or exceed the minimum requirements shall be borne by the City. | ||||||
